The King Edward VII Memorial Sanitorium at Hertford Hill, Warwick

The King Edward VII Memorial Sanitorium at Hertford Hill, Warwick, a centre for the treatment of tuberculosis, now has a chest surgery unit. Chest surgery, technically called thoracic surgery, is a highly specialised branch of medical work which has made rapid developments in the last few years. The unit comprises a staff of 40 with an operating theatre suite and an x-ray department.
19th September 1954
